Key inclusion & exclusion criteria
Inclusion criteria:
- Male or female, 18 years of age or older.
- ECOG performance status of 0 or 1.
- Life expectancy > 3 months.
- Histologically confirmed adenocarcinoma of the stomach or GEJ with inoperable metastatic disease not amenable to curative therapy.
- Adequate archival or newly obtained formalin-fixed paraffin-embedded (FFPE) tissue for central IHC assay of Met receptor and HER2 status.
- Tumor (either primary or metastatic lesion) defined as Met positive by IHC (>/= 50% of tumor cells with membrane and/or cytoplasmic staining at weak, moderate, or high intensity)
- Measurable disease or non-measurable but evaluable disease, according to the Response Evaluation Criteria in Solid Tumors (RECIST v1.1).
Patients with peritoneal disease would generally be regarded as having evaluable disease and be allowed to enter the trial.

Exclusion criteria:
- HER2-positive tumor (primary tumor or metastasis)
HER2-positivity is defined as either IHC 3+ or IHC 2+/ISH+; ISH positivity is defined as a HER2:CEP17 ratio of >/= 2.0.
- Previous chemotherapy for locally advanced or metastatic gastric carcinoma Patients may have received either neoadjuvant or adjuvant chemotherapy as long as it was completed at least 6 months prior to randomization.
- Prior exposure to experimental treatment targeting either the HGF or Met pathway.
- History of another malignancy within the previous 5 years, except for appropriately treated carcinoma in situ of the cervix, non-melanoma skin carcinoma, Stage I uterine cancer, or other malignancies with an expected curative outcome
Hematologic, Biochemical, and Organ Function
- Granulocyte count < 1500/mm3, platelet count < 100,000/mm3,
and hemoglobin < 9.0 g/dL within 7 days prior to enrollment.
- Partial thromboplastin time (PTT), international normalized ratio (INR), or prothrombin time (PT) > 1.5 x the upper limit of normal (ULN), except for patients receiving anticoagulation therapy.
- AST (SGOT), ALT (SGPT), alkaline phosphatase (ALP) >/= 2.5 × ULN (>/= 5 × ULN with liver metastases)
- Total bilirubin >/= 1.5 × ULN (except in patients diagnosed with
Gilbert's disease)
- Serum calcium > ULN (corrected for low serum albumin concentrations) Corrected calcium (mg/dL) = serum Ca2+ + [(4.0-measured serum albumin) x 0.8] Corrected calcium (mmol/L) = serum Ca2+ + 0.02 × (40-serum albumin)
- Serum creatinine > 1.5 × ULN or calculated creatinine
clearance < 60 mL/min (Cockcroft and Gault 1976)
- Uncontrolled diabetes as evidenced by fasting serum glucose
level > 200 mg/dL
- Clinically significant gastrointestinal abnormalities, apart from gastric cancer, including uncontrolled inflammatory gastrointestinal diseases (Crohn's disease, ulcerative colitis, etc.)
- Known active infection with human immunodeficiency virus (HIV), hepatitis B virus (HBV), or hepatitis C virus (HCV), or known HIVseropositivity.
- Major surgery within 4 weeks before start of study treatment, without complete recovery.

Primary Outcome(s)
Timepoint(s) of evaluation of this end point: OS is defined as the time from randomization to death due to any
cause.
Primary end point(s): - One interim efficacy and futility analysis planned for the Met 2+/3+ subgroup occurring at the time of the ITT final analysis, which is triggered by obtaining 67% of total OS information (79 events) from the Met 2+/3+ subgroup and 449 events from the ITT population.
- Final efficacy analysis for the 2+/3+ subgroup triggered by 118 OS events (this will likely occur after the final analysis of the ITT population).
Secondary Objective: - To evaluate the efficacy of onartuzumab + mFOLFOX6 relative to placebo + mFOLFOX6 as measured by PFS and ORR in the Met 2+/3+ subgroup and in the ITT population.
- To evaluate the safety of onartuzumab + mFOLFOX6 compared with placebo + mFOLFOX6 in patients with HER2-negative metastatic GEC, focusing on all adverse events, National Cancer Institute Common Terminology Criteria for Adverse Events
(NCI CTCAE v4.0) Grade >/= 3 adverse events, and Grade >/= 3 laboratory toxicities.
- To compare patient-reported outcomes (PROs) following treatment with onartuzumab + mFOLFOX6 relative to placebo + mFOLFOX6, as measured by the EORTC QLQ-C30 and its gastric cancer module (the QLQ-STO22), of the two treatment arms in the
Met 2+/3+ subgroup and in the ITT population.
- To characterize the pharmacokinetics of onartuzumab when given with mFOLFOX6.
- To evaluate serum levels and incidence of anti-therapeutic antibodies (ATAs) against onartuzumab.
Main Objective: - To evaluate the efficacy of onartuzumab + mFOLFOX6 compared withplacebo + mFOLFOX6 as measured by overall survival (OS) in patients with previouslyuntreated HER2-negative metastatic gastroesophageal cancer (GEC) classified asMet-IHC 2+ or 3+ (Met 2+/3+ subgroup).
- To evaluate the efficacy of onartuzumab + mFOLFOX6 compared with placebo + mFOLFOX6 as measured by OS in patients with previously untreated HER2-negative metastatic GEC classified as Met-IHC 1+, 2+, or 3+ (intent-to-treat [ITT] population).
